What Is Mytravelsday.xyz?
Mytravelsday.xyz is identified as a Trojan-type threat. Trojans are malicious programs that can infiltrate your system by disguising themselves as legitimate software. Once inside, they can cause a variety of problems, including data theft, system crashes, and the installation of additional malware. The name Mytravelsday.xyz itself does not directly indicate a known malware family, but its behavior and impact on infected systems classify it as a significant threat.
How Mytravelsday.xyz Operates
Trojan-type threats like Mytravelsday.xyz typically operate by exploiting vulnerabilities in software or tricking users into installing them. They can be distributed through various means, including email attachments, infected software downloads, and compromised websites. Once installed, Mytravelsday.xyz may communicate with its command and control servers to receive instructions, which could include stealing sensitive information, downloading additional malware, or using the infected computer as part of a botnet for malicious activities.
Symptoms of Infection
Symptoms of a Mytravelsday.xyz infection can vary but may include unusual system behavior such as slow performance, frequent crashes, or the appearance of unwanted programs and pop-ups. You might also notice changes in your browser settings or the presence of toolbars and extensions you did not install. In some cases, the infection might not display obvious symptoms immediately, making it crucial to regularly scan your system for malware.
